How Precision Plots Work
So, what makes precision plots so effective? The answer lies in their mechanics. A precision plot is a type of line graph that uses a combination of data points and trend lines to showcase patterns and trends in data. By using a precise and clear visual representation, precision plots allow users to quickly identify relationships between data points and make informed decisions based on the insights gained.
The beauty of precision plots lies in their flexibility. They can be used to display a wide range of data types, from simple time-series data to complex multivariate analysis. Additionally, precision plots can be customized to suit various needs, making them an invaluable tool for professionals in all industries.
